    Bryant was born on November 3, 1794, in a log cabin near Cummington, Massachusetts; the home of his birth is today marked with a plaque. He was the second son of Peter Bryant, a doctor and later a state legislator, and Sarah Snell. His maternal ancestry traces back to passengers on the Mayflower; his father's, to colonists who arrived about a dozen years later. Bryant and his family moved to a new home when he was two years old. The William Cullen Bryant Homestead, his boyhood home, is now a museum.…

    Linus Pauling Linus Pauling was born on February 28,1901 in Portland, Oregon. He started his early education in Oregon. When he graduated from the Oregon Agricultural college in Corvallis (Now is called Oregon State University) in 1922, he had a bachelor's degree in chemical engineering. For his postgraduate study Linus went to the California Institute of Technology(A.K.A. Caltech). There, he got his Ph.D in chemistry and mathematical physics in 1925.…

    “Without the element of enjoyment, it is not worth trying to excel at anything.” Magnus Carlsen currently stands as the world chess champion with his prevailing chess rating as 2834 and his IQ as 190, Magnus Carlsen was born November 30, 1990, in Tonsberg, Norway to Sigrun Oen, a chemical engineer and Henrik Albert Carlsen, an IT consultant, he’s been nicknamed “The Mozart Of Chess.” Magnus Carlsen commenced playing chess at the age of 5 when his father educated him about the game, but he didn’t comprehend it seriously until he was 8 just after his sister Ellen was getting exceptional in the game. Carlsen beat his father at the age of ten, moreover, he suddenly went on to start training with chess Grandmaster Simon Agdenstein at the age of 12. The first chess book Carlsen ever read was a book called Find the Play by Bent Larsen.…
